CNE Opens South China Hub for Crossborder Ecommerce Growth

CNE Express's South China Sorting Center is officially operational, with a daily processing capacity of one million parcels, tripling its previous output. This center is a key step in CNE's strategic layout in East and South China, significantly enhancing its overall operational capabilities and providing more efficient and stable logistics services for cross-border e-commerce sellers. The opening ceremony brought together numerous e-commerce platforms, major sellers, service providers, and government leaders, witnessing this significant industry event.

Uaes Noon Invests in Mega Logistics Hub to Boost Ecommerce

Noon is building the UAE's largest logistics center in Abu Dhabi, spanning 252,000 square meters, expected to open in 2024 and create 6,000 jobs. This aims to improve delivery speed and accelerate the development of e-commerce infrastructure in the Middle East. Despite inflation, the UAE e-commerce market remains strong, with sales projected to reach $9.2 billion in 2026. This move by Noon could help it become a dominant player in the Middle Eastern e-commerce landscape.

US Import Growth Persists Despite Port Strike Concerns

Despite the looming threat of port strikes on the East and Gulf Coasts, US import volumes remain high. Reports indicate that retailers are front-loading shipments to mitigate strike risks and concerns about future tariff changes, driving the increase. However, port congestion is escalating, challenging supply chain management. Businesses need to closely monitor market dynamics and adapt their supply chain strategies to navigate the uncertainties. The potential strike action adds further complexity to an already strained global logistics network.

Union Pacific Norfolk Southern Pursue Transcontinental Rail Merger

Union Pacific and Norfolk Southern have submitted a merger application to create the first transcontinental railroad in the United States, connecting the East and West Coasts and over a hundred ports. This initiative aims to improve transportation efficiency, reduce costs, and boost trade. However, potential impacts on market competition, employment, and the environment need to be considered. The merger's success hinges on addressing these concerns while realizing the promised benefits of a more streamlined and integrated national rail network.

Saudi Arabia Promotes Trade Facilitation at WCO MENA Seminar

The World Customs Organization (WCO) held a Middle East and North Africa regional seminar in Saudi Arabia, focusing on the application of advance rulings in tariff classification and origin rules. This system aims to improve trade efficiency, reduce costs, enhance transparency, and promote compliance. Participants discussed implementation challenges, with Saudi Arabia playing an active role in regional cooperation. The seminar's outcomes contribute to promoting regional trade facilitation and creating a more predictable trading environment for businesses.

Chinabulgaria Flight Options Expand Amid Rising Travel Demand

This article provides a detailed guide on flying from China to Bulgaria, covering routes, flight duration, ticket prices, visa requirements, and time zone differences. As there are no direct flights, transfers are typically required in Europe or the Middle East. The flight duration is approximately 15-20 hours, and round-trip economy class tickets range from 6000-12000 RMB. Additionally, it's necessary to obtain a visa in advance and be aware of the time difference, local currency, and language.

Ocean Alliance to Transform Global Shipping Industry

The 'Ocean Alliance,' comprised of four major shipping companies, plans to deploy 350 container ships, offering 40 East-West routes connecting 100 ports, aiming to reshape global trade patterns. Approved by the U.S., and awaiting approval from China and the EU, its establishment will enhance shipping efficiency, strengthen market competitiveness, and promote trade development. However, the alliance also faces challenges such as member coordination, market competition, and regulatory risks. Its impact on the global shipping industry will be significant.

Changshauaesaudi Arabia Trade Lane Enhances Efficiency

The Changsha-UAE/Saudi Arabia air-sea freight line combines the speed of air transport with the economy of sea transport, providing an efficient cross-border logistics solution. Standardized processes ensure cargo security. The entire journey takes approximately 10-15 days, supporting various trade goods and boosting the development of China-Saudi Arabia trade. This service offers a cost-effective and reliable option for businesses looking to optimize their supply chains between China and the Middle East.
